Lot Bush Hogging in Prince Georges County, MD
Lot bush hogging services involve the use of heavy-duty mowing equipment to clear overgrown fields, pastures, and large open areas. This service is ideal for property owners who need to maintain large tracts of land, remove thick brush, or prepare fields for planting or recreational use. Typically, projects include clearing abandoned lots, managing overgrown farmland, or maintaining expansive properties that require efficient and thorough vegetation removal. Homeowners considering bush hogging should understand the size of the area to be cleared, the type of vegetation present, and any obstacles such as rocks or debris that could affect the equipment’s operation.
Before requesting bush hogging services, property owners often want to know about the scope of work, including the extent of vegetation to be removed and the condition of the land. It’s helpful to communicate any specific goals, such as creating a clear space for future development or livestock grazing. Additionally, understanding the accessibility of the property and whether any land preparation is needed can ensure the service meets expectations. Proper planning and clear communication about the property’s features can help achieve the desired results efficiently.

Lot Bush Hogging Questions
What is lot bush hogging? Lot bush hogging involves clearing overgrown grass, weeds, and brush from large outdoor areas to maintain a tidy appearance and prevent overgrowth.
What types of properties benefit from bush hogging? Properties such as vacant land, farms, large residential lots, and commercial sites often require bush hogging to manage vegetation.
How does bush hogging improve property maintenance? It helps control invasive plants, reduces fire hazards, and prepares land for future use or development.
Is bush hogging suitable for uneven or rough terrain? Yes, bush hogging is effective on uneven, rocky, or overgrown terrain, making it ideal for challenging outdoor spaces.
